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ing water intrusion and moisture buildup beneath a building. This process typically involves installing drainage systems, vapor barriers, and sometimes sump pumps to manage water that may seep into the crawlspace. The goal is to create a dry environment that reduces the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by excess moisture. Proper waterproofing can also help improve indoor air quality by limiting mold spores and musty odors that originate from damp crawlspaces.
Addressing moisture problems in crawlspaces is essential for maintaining the integrity of a property’s foundation. Excess moisture can lead to wood rot, pest infestations, and increased wear on structural components. By implementing waterproofing measures, property owners can mitigate these risks and protect the longevity of their buildings. Additionally, waterproofing can contribute to better energy efficiency, as a dry crawlspace helps prevent temperature fluctuations that can impact heating and cooling costs.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a crawlspace waterproofing system typ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the size of the area and the extent of work needed.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range.
Moisture Barrier Expenses - Installing a vapor barrier in the crawlspace usually costs between $500 and $2,000. The price varies based on the material quality and the size of the space.
Drainage System Pricing - Adding drainage solutions such as sump pumps or French drains can cost from $1,000 to $4,000. The final price depends on the system type and the complexity of installation.
Inspection and Assessment Fees - Some service providers charge between $100 and $300 for a thorough crawlspace inspection and assessment. This fee may be included in the overall project cost or billed separately.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
